Acetic acid is to be extracted from a dilute aqueous solution with isopropyl ether at 25oC in a countercurrent cascade of mixer-settler units. In one of the units, the following conditions apply:

Extract Raffinate Flow rate, lb/h Density, Ib/ft3 Viscosity, cP 21,000 63.5 52,000 45.3 3.0 1.0

Interfacial tension =13.5 dyne/cm. If the raffinate is the dispersed phase and the mixer residence time is 2.5 minutes, estimate for the mixer:

(a) The dimensions of a closed, baffled vessel,

(b) The diameter of a flat-bladed impeller,

(c) The minimum rate of rotation in revolutions per minute of the impeller for complete and uniform dispersion, and

(d) The power requirement of the agitator at the minimum rate of rotation.
